Re: transition of cgal to testing



On 02/05/16 18:25, Joachim Reichel wrote:
> Hi,
> 
> https://qa.debian.org/excuses.php?package=cgal says:
> 
> 7 days old (needed 5 days)
> old binaries left on armhf: libcgal-qt5-11, libcgal-qt5-dev (from 4.7-4) (but
> ignoring cruft, so nevermind)
> Valid candidate
> 
> (It is intended that these two binary packages are no longer built for armhf.)
> 
> Why does the package not transition to testing? Is maybe "ignoring cruft, so
> nevermind" not correct? Do I need to do something to these two binary packages
> removed first?

You need to get the package decrufted. You can file a RM bug against
ftp.debian.org for that.
